Torre Annunziata killed for parking, Cerrato's wife: "The murderers will always have a fight with me"

Tania Sorrentino, wife of Maurizio Cerrato, the custodian of the Archaeological Park of Pompeii killed on April 19, 2021 in Torre Annunziata for an argument over a parking space, does not back down one step: 'I'm staying in Torre Annunziata, like them, and they'll always have a fight against me.'

Her words, addressed to her husband's killers, reveal the same determination she displayed in the first instance. The second instance trial began today at the Naples Court of Assizes of Appeal, with four defendants all sentenced to 23 years in prison in the first instance.

Two of them were connected via video conference from prison, while the other two were present in the courtroom, one behind bars and the other, elderly and under house arrest, with walking difficulties.

During the hearing, the Municipality of Torre Annunziata and the Polis Foundation joined the proceedings as civil parties. The judge explained the reasons for the first-instance ruling and the grounds for the appeal filed by both the prosecutor and the defendants' lawyers.

Cerrato's wife annoyed by requests for acquittal by the defendants' lawyers

The wife of Cerrato, present in the courtroom with her daughter Maria Adriana, involved in the attack, expressed sorrow and perplexity regarding the request for acquittal by the defendants' lawyers: 'My husband certainly didn't grab a knife and stab himself with the knife that killed him.'

At the end of the hearing, the judge set the schedule for the next stages of the trial, which will resume on June 10th with the Deputy Prosecutor General's closing statement and the closing arguments of the civil party lawyers.
